Atlanta: The Foote and Davies Company, 1900. Third edition. Hardcover. Near fine in original green cloth decorated in blind and lettered in gilt on the upper cover and spine.. Octavo. 6.25 x 9 inches. 229 [i] pp. Frontispiece portrait of Robert Anderson. Anderson was born into slavery in Liberty County, Georgia. When his master died, he bought himself out of slavery from his mistress for $1000 and his wife for $500 with the meager earnings he had accumulated. All early editions of his book are very scarce.
